Devdatta Madhav Dharmadhikari (born 14 August 1940) is the former supreme court judge. He got in the office on 5 March 2002 and was retired on 13 August 2005. He was appointed as the chief justice of Gujarat High Court on 25 January 2000 before this. His father Yashwant Dharmadhikari was also a senior advocate.

In December 2023, Gujarat Police complied with a Gujarat High Court order, initiating a case against Rajiv Modi. [11] The case involves accusations of rape, assault, and intentional insult by a Bulgarian woman employed as a flight attendant and personal assistant at the company.

A judge of Gujarat High Court, Jhaveri succeeded Chief Justice Vineet Saran, who has been elevated to the Supreme Court. On 19 July the Supreme Court Collegium had recommended Jhaveri's name for appointment as the Chief Justice of Orissa HC and the Ministry of Law and Justice had issued a notification in this regard.
